adds safety quotes and '-[0-9]' before wildcard as suggested in PR #6 comments
authorJoshua C. Randall <jcrandall@alum.mit.edu>
Fri, 19 Feb 2016 14:11:47 +0000 (14:11 +0000)
committerJoshua C. Randall <jcrandall@alum.mit.edu>
Fri, 19 Feb 2016 14:11:47 +0000 (14:11 +0000)
jenkins/run-library.sh

index 7198345b117590e974dd5287ff0dfd95a6102898..117e2d2a832039138737ac49d978cf9b0683b62a 100755 (executable)
@@ -270,7 +270,7 @@ fpm_build () {
               apt-get install -y "$pkg"
           fi
       else
-          pkg_rpm=$(ls $WORKSPACE/packages/$TARGET/$pkg*.rpm | sort -rg | awk 'NR==1')
+          pkg_rpm=$(ls "$WORKSPACE/packages/$TARGET/$pkg"-[0-9]*.rpm | sort -rg | awk 'NR==1')
           if [[ -e $pkg_rpm ]]; then
               echo "Installing build_dep $pkg from $pkg_rpm"
               rpm -i "$pkg_rpm"